NEW DELHI, Nov 13: In a major breakthrough in the Red Fort blast probe, DNA test results have confirmed that Dr Umar Nabi was driving the car that exploded near the historic monument earlier this week, police sources said on Thursday.

Samples collected from the blast site were matched with those of Umar’s mother, taken on Tuesday and sent for forensic analysis, officials said. “The DNA results confirm that it was indeed Umar who was driving the fateful vehicle,” a source revealed.

Umar, a resident of Koil village in Pulwama, Jammu and Kashmir, was a key operative of a “white-collar” terror module recently busted by security agencies. The group was linked to Jaish-e-Mohammed and Ansar Ghazwat-ul-Hind, police said.
